Best Internet Options for a Portugal Surf Trip
| Option | Best For | Main Limitation |
|---|---|---|
| Portugal eSIM | Most surfers and surf travelers | Requires eSIM-compatible unlocked phone |
| Physical SIM Card | Older phones without eSIM | Requires store visit and SIM replacement |
| Roaming | Short trips with included roaming | Costs and fair usage depend on provider |
| Public WiFi | Surf camps, cafes, hotels, hostels | Not useful on beaches or road trips |
| Pocket WiFi | Groups and surf camps | Extra device to carry and charge |

How Much Data Do You Need for a Portugal Surf Trip?
| Surf Trip Style | Recommended Data |
|---|---|
| Short surf weekend | 1GB – 3GB |
| One-week surf trip | 5GB – 15GB |
| Surf road trip with maps and forecasts | 15GB – 30GB |
| Photo and video uploads | 20GB – 40GB |
| Remote work plus surf travel | 30GB+ or unlimited recommended |
What Uses the Most Data During a Surf Trip?
- Uploading surf videos
- Instagram Reels and TikTok
- Video streaming
- Cloud photo backups
- Video calls
- Hotspot sharing
- Downloading maps, apps, or files
Surf forecasts, Google Maps, WhatsApp, and basic browsing usually use much less data than video uploads and streaming.

Can You Keep Your Home SIM Active?
Yes. Most modern smartphones support dual SIM functionality.
This allows surfers to use a Portugal eSIM for mobile data while keeping their regular SIM active for calls, SMS verification codes, banking apps, authentication messages, and WhatsApp on the same number.
Do You Need Data Roaming Enabled?
Yes. Most travel eSIM plans require data roaming to be enabled on the eSIM line.
If data roaming is disabled, mobile internet may not work correctly even if the eSIM is installed.

What If Internet Does Not Work at the Beach?
- Make sure the Portugal eSIM is selected for mobile data.
- Enable data roaming on the Portugal eSIM line.
- Restart your phone.
- Turn airplane mode on for 30 seconds and then off.
- Check APN settings if needed.
- Disable VPN or Data Saver temporarily.
- Wait several minutes for network registration.
- Move away from cliffs, valleys, or remote beach areas if signal is weak.
